waters molar mass is 18.01 g/mol. the molar mass of glycerol is 92.09 g/mol. at 25°c, glycerol is more viscous than water. which substance has the stronger intermolecular attraction?\no glycerol because it has a larger molar mass\no glycerol because it is more viscous and has a larger molar mass\no water because it has a lower molar mass\no water because it is less viscous and has a lower molar mass
Answer
Answer:
glycerol because it is more viscous and has a larger molar mass
Brief Explanations:
Viscosity is related to intermolecular forces. Stronger intermolecular attractions lead to higher viscosity. Also, larger - molar - mass substances often have stronger intermolecular forces due to more electrons and greater London dispersion forces in many cases. Glycerol is more viscous and has a larger molar mass, indicating stronger intermolecular attractions.
